A short bob with a 1920s look
A bob that has become a little too short can easily be converted into a beautiful page cut in the 20s look - the classic bob haircut.
- To do this, you must first straighten your hair (in case your hair is wavy or curly). To do this, apply some setting agent to the dry hair, comb it through well with a fine comb and twist the hair on thick Velcro rollers.
- Leave the curlers on for about 20 minutes and blow-dry them briefly.
- Then carefully pull the Velcro roller out of your hair and blow-dry the tips into an inner roll using a thick round brush.
- If this is too time-consuming for you, simply use a straightening iron. This also allows the tips to be turned inwards nicely.
- Now draw an exact, deep side parting and comb the hair to the side.
- Now tease the lower area - not the roots - and neatly comb the top hair over it.
- Leave a strand loosely on one side face hang and clamp the hair behind the ear on the other side.
- So that everything lasts well, you should fix the hairstyle with hair lacquer or hairspray.

Wild styling - when the bob is too short
Another option for beautiful styling when the bob has gotten too short would be a wild curly hairstyle.
- If you have natural curls, all you have to do is shape them a little so that the hairstyle doesn't look too disheveled.
- To do this, apply a spray treatment to dry hair that does not need to be washed out and twist in individual strands with your fingers. This will make the curls look neater.
- If your hair is naturally rather straight, then twist it on papillots or heating rollers.
- It is of course easiest if you twist your hair into small curls with the curling iron.
- Toup the hair a little from below, especially in the back area, and then carefully comb the top hair over it with a very coarsely toothed comb.
- As a result, the hairstyle now has a lot of volume and nobody notices that your bob has actually become too short.
